Curried Pumpkin Soup Recipe
  • Prep/Total Time: 30 min.
  • Yield: 6 Servings

Ingredients

  • 1/3 cup chopped onion
  • 1/2 teaspoon minced garlic
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1/2 teaspoon curry pow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on ground coriander
  • Dash crushed red pepper flakes
  • 1-1/2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 cup half-and-half cream
  • 3/4 cup canned pumpkin

Directions

  • In a large saucepan, saute onion and garlic in butter until tender. Stir in the curry powder, salt, coriander and pepper flakes; cook and stir for 1 minute. Stir in broth until blended.
  • Bring to a boil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 15 minutes. Whisk in the cream and pumpkin; heat through (do not boil). Yield: 6 servings.

Nutritional Facts 1 serving (1 cup) equals 105 calories, 8 g fat (5 g saturated fat), 30 mg cholesterol, 391 mg sodium, 5 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 3 g protein.
